The earliest that you can plant garden cress in Pontiac is April. However, you really should wait until May if you don't want to take any chances.

The last month that you can plant garden cress and expect a good harvest is probably August. You probably don't want to wait any later than that or else your garden cress may not have a chance to really do well. If you are starting your garden cress indoors then you might be able to get away with starting them a little bit earlier.

Last Frost Date

On average all chance of frost has passed is on April 15 in Pontiac. You should expect an average low temperature of -15°F in the coldest months of winter.

Remember that USDA zone info for Pontiac is an average and the actual date of last frost changes from year to year. Half of the time in Pontiac you get a frost after April 15 so be sure to be ready to cover your garden cress in the event of a late frost.

USDA Zone Info for Pontiac

Here is the info for USDA Zone 5b.

Average Date of Last Frost (spring)April 15
Average Date of First Frost (fall)October 15
Lowest Expected Low-15°F
Highest Expected Low-10°F

This means that on a really cold year, the coldest it will get is -15°F. On most years you should be prepared to experience lows near -10°F.
